For homes near Apple Creek and in the lower-lying parts of Wooster, a summer thunderstorm can mean a wet basement by morning. Basement flooding summer storms cause here usually comes down to two forces working together: rain that arrives faster than the ground and drainage can handle, and groundwater that rises until it's pressing against the foundation from below.

The water tends to arrive quietly, below grade, where it isn't noticed until it's already pooling. By the time a homeowner spots it, moisture has often been seeping in for hours.

Summer Thunderstorms Bring Intense Rainfall in Short Periods

In Wooster neighborhoods, an inch or more of rain can fall in well under an hour, and that pace is the heart of the problem. Drainage systems, gutters, downspouts, storm drains, are built for steady rain, not for a sudden deluge.

When that much water lands fast, several things happen at once:

  • High-volume rainfall arrives faster than drainage can carry it away.
  • Stormwater accumulates rapidly across yards, streets, and low spots.
  • Soil that's already saturated from previous rain can't absorb any more.
  • The excess becomes runoff, and a lot of it heads toward homes.

Basement flooding summer storms produce traces back to this timing. The same total rainfall spread across a day would drain off without much trouble. Compressed into thirty minutes, it overwhelms everything in its path.

Why Are Homes Near Apple Creek More Vulnerable to Flooding?

Geography does most of the work here. Apple Creek rises during heavy rain, and homes nearby sit at lower elevations where water naturally collects. When the creek climbs and runoff pours in from higher ground, the low-lying neighborhoods become the place all that water ends up.

The pattern is consistent:

  • Apple Creek's water level rises during and after heavy storms.
  • Low-lying terrain gathers runoff flowing down from surrounding higher ground.
  • Water naturally moves toward and pools in these areas.
  • Drainage runs slower here than at higher elevations, so water lingers.

Apple Creek flooding affecting homes has become a recurring concern in these neighborhoods. The elevation that makes them vulnerable doesn't change, which means the same homes tend to face the same risk storm after storm.

Saturated Soil Pushes Water Toward Foundations

There's a second mechanism beyond surface runoff, and it's the one that does the quieter damage. When the soil around a foundation becomes fully saturated, it can't hold any more water. The groundwater level rises, and all that water pressing against the foundation creates hydrostatic pressure, force pushing inward on basement walls and floors.

That pressure finds the weak points. A hairline crack in the wall, a gap at the floor-wall joint, porous concrete, any of them becomes a path for water under pressure. Groundwater rise and the basement flooding it causes develop gradually this way, often without any dramatic surface flooding at all. The water doesn't pour in; it's pushed in, seeping through openings that stay dry in normal conditions.

What Early Signs of Basement Flooding Do Homeowners Miss?

The first indicators are easy to overlook, especially in a basement that doesn't get checked often. Watch for:

  • A damp or musty smell that wasn't there before the storm.
  • Small areas of pooling or seepage along walls and floor seams.
  • Discoloration on lower walls or near the base of the foundation.
  • Indoor humidity that feels higher than usual downstairs.

Storm runoff basement leaks tend to show up through one of these first. The musty smell is the most reliable early signal, it appears before any visible water, which means moisture is already present in the materials. Catching it at that stage is the difference between a minor fix and a major one.

How Do Thunderstorms Lead to Widespread Water Damage?

Once water is in the basement, even a small amount, it doesn't stay contained. It soaks into drywall along the lower walls, into wood framing in finished spaces, and into flooring and anything stored at floor level. Concrete absorbs it and holds it, keeping everything in contact damp far longer than it would dry on its own.

Mold gets going fast in these conditions, often within a couple of days, in the damp, dark, low-airflow spaces a flooded basement provides. From there the damage spreads into adjacent rooms and finished areas. Heavy rain basement water intrusion becomes extensive when the source keeps feeding moisture in, since each storm adds more water before the last round has dried.

Damage Often Continues After the Storm Ends

The rain stops, but the basement doesn't dry on its own. Saturated soil holds water against the foundation for days after the storm, so the pressure pushing moisture inward eases slowly. The materials that absorbed water stay wet, and a basement's poor airflow and natural humidity work against any drying.

That lingering moisture is where the real trouble develops. Mold forms in hidden areas. Odors strengthen. Repair needs grow the longer materials stay damp. Low-lying area basement flooding effects tend to linger well past the storm itself, which is exactly why drying the space thoroughly matters as much as clearing the visible water.

Preventing Basement Flooding in Wooster Homes

Most of this risk responds to drainage and foundation maintenance:

  • Improve grading so the soil slopes water away from the foundation.
  • Keep gutters clear and extend downspouts several feet from the house.
  • Install or maintain a sump pump if the basement has any history of moisture.
  • Seal visible foundation cracks and gaps around pipe penetrations.
  • Inspect the basement after every significant storm for new dampness or seepage.

Wooster homeowners in the lower-lying neighborhoods who stay ahead of drainage, and check the basement after each heavy rain, catch most problems while they're still small.
